Your boiler's internal pump is detecting a communication error or is set to the wrong operating mode, meaning it cannot circulate water properly.
Book a Gas Safe engineer within 24–48 hours. Your boiler may be unsafe or could break down completely if left.
Technical description: Pump switch mode
What causes this fault?
This fault occurs when the boiler's control board loses touch with the internal pump or notices it is running in the wrong setting. The most common reason is an electronic communication failure between the pump and the main computer, often caused by a loose connection or a failing pump motor. Without this connection, the boiler cannot safely move hot water around your system, so it shuts down to prevent overheating.
